What Are Heinz Bodies?
Heinz bodies are insoluble hemoglobin precipitates that form within red blood cells when hemoglobin molecules undergo oxidative denaturation. These microscopic aggregates appear as small, round inclusions that attach to the inner surface of red blood cell membranes. The presence of Heinz bodies indicates that red blood cells have been exposed to oxidative stress, which can compromise their structural integrity and functional capacity.

Clinical Significance
The detection of Heinz bodies serves as an important diagnostic marker for several hematological conditions. When present in significant numbers, these inclusions can lead to premature destruction of red blood cells, resulting in hemolytic anemia. The test helps clinicians differentiate between various types of anemia and identify the underlying causes of red blood cell destruction.
Who Should Consider This Test?
Symptoms and Clinical Indications
Healthcare providers typically recommend the Heinz Bodies Peripheral Blood Test for patients presenting with:
- Unexplained fatigue and weakness
- Pale skin or jaundice (yellowing of skin and eyes)
- Dark-colored urine
- Shortness of breath during normal activities
- Rapid heart rate without apparent cause
- Family history of hemolytic disorders
- Suspected G6PD deficiency
- Exposure to oxidative drugs or chemicals
- Unexplained hemolytic episodes
Risk Factors
Individuals with specific risk factors should consider this test, including those with:
- Known hemoglobinopathies
- Family history of blood disorders
- Recent medication changes involving oxidative drugs
- Occupational exposure to oxidative chemicals
- Ethnic backgrounds with higher prevalence of G6PD deficiency
